Do this when the lights are on, as dinoflagellates are highly photosynthetic and will be most plentiful sometime during your photoperiod. This type of dino is perfectly suited to be eradicated with a UV sterilizer. If you find your tank is starved of nitrate and phosphate, dosing something like Brightwell NeoNitro or NeoPhos to increase nitrate and phosphate levels to a healthy balance has been known to out-compete dinos. MicroBacter7 andBrightwell MicroBacter CLEANare formulated to help digest uneaten food, detritus, and other organic material. You will need to turn off the lights and cover all the glass panels completely to block out ambient light.
